Annual Bibliography of English Language and Literature : ABELL

The Annual Bibliography of English Language and Literature (ABELL) lists monographs, periodical articles, critical editions of literary works, book reviews and collections of essays published anywhere in the world; unpublished doctoral dissertations are covered for the period 1920–1999. The bibliography consists of 80 volumes, beginning in 1920 and issued annually; a number of items published between 1892 and 1919 has been indexed retrospectively.

This release of ABELL covers the complete volumes from 1920–2007.

Bernoulli

Bernoulli is published by the Bernoulli Society for Mathematical Statistics and Probability and disseminated by the Institute of Mathematical Statistics on behalf of the Bernoulli Society. The journal provides a comprehensive account of important developments in the fields of statistics and probability, offering an international forum for both theoretical and applied work.

Portugaliae Mathematica

Published by the European Mathematical Society with the support of the Portuguese Science Foundation.

Since its foundation in 1937, Portugaliae Mathematica has aimed at publishing high-level research articles in all branches of mathematics. With great efforts by its founders, the journal was able to publish articles by some of the best mathematicians of the time. In 2001 a New Series of Portugaliae Mathematica was started, reaffirming the purpose of maintaining a high-level research journal in mathematics with a wide range scope.

Wasafiri

Wasafiri is a literary magazine at the forefront in mapping new landscapes in contemporary international literature today. In over twenty years of publishing, it has continued to provide consistent coverage to Britain’s diverse cultural heritage and publishes a range of diasporic and migrant writing worldwide. Since its inception in 1984, it has focused on writing as a form of cultural travelling (‘wasafiri’ is ‘Kiswahili’ for traveller) and extended the established boundaries of literary culture.

Journal of the American Planning Association

For more than 70 years, the quarterly Journal of the American Planning Association (JAPA) has published research, commentaries, and book reviews useful to practicing planners, policymakers, scholars, students, and citizens of urban, suburban, and rural areas.

JAPA publishes only peer-reviewed, original research and analysis. It aspires to bring insight to planning the future, to air a variety of perspectives, to publish the highest quality work, and to engage readers.
